repo.or.cz
/
wine
/
multimedia.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Disable strict draw ordering by default.
2010-04-13
Henri
V
erbeet
wined3d: D
i
sable strict draw or
d
e
r
ing b
y
d
e
fault
.
commit
|
commitdiff
|
tree
2010-04-13
Henri Ver
b
e
et
wi
n
ed3d
:
Add a
s
eparate
f
u
nc
t
i
o
n
for palette initi
a
li
z
a
t
ion
.
commit
|
commitdiff
|
tree
2010-04-13
Henri Verb
e
e
t
w
i
ned3d: Add a
s
e
parate
f
u
n
ction fo
r
r
en
d
e
rtarget vi
e
w
.
.
.
commit
|
commitdiff
|
tree
2010-04-12
Henri
V
erbeet
w
inex11
.
drv: Allow
O
penGL on minim
i
zed window
s
.
commit
|
commitdiff
|
tree
2010-04-12
H
enri Verbeet
wine
d
3d: Don't
writ
e
past th
e
end of the b
u
ffer's con
v
ersion
.
.
.
commit
|
commitdiff
|
tree
2010-04-12
Henri Verbeet
wined3d: Fix a GL extension prototype
.
commit
|
commitdiff
|
tree
2010-04-12
H
enri Verbeet
d3d8/tests: Add some depth buffe
r
t
e
sts
.
commit
|
commitdiff
|
tree
2010-04-12
Henri
V
erbeet
d3
d
9/t
e
st
s
:
A
dd some depth buffer
t
ests
.
commit
|
commitdiff
|
tree
2010-04-08
Hen
r
i
V
er
b
eet
wined3d: Add a FIXME for p
r
ed
i
c
ated shader
i
n
s
tru
c
tions
.
commit
|
commitdiff
|
tree
2010-04-08
Henr
i
Verbeet
wined3d:
Va
l
id
a
t
e some
m
o
re
s
tate
s
.
commit
|
commitdiff
|
tree
2010-04-08
H
e
nri Verbe
e
t
wined3d: Upd
a
t
e shad
e
r
c
onstants o
n
view
p
ort changes
.
commit
|
commitdiff
|
tree
2010-04-08
H
enri Verbeet
wi
n
ed3d:
G
e
t
r
i
d of state_nogl()
.
commit
|
commitdiff
|
tree
2010-04-08
Henri Verbeet
wined3d:
Add an extensionless S
T
A
TE_INDEXBUFF
E
R hand
l
er
.
commit
|
commitdiff
|
tree
2010-04-07
Henri Verb
e
et
w
i
ned3d
:
Add a separat
e
fun
c
t
i
o
n for a
d
di
n
g de
c
l
a
ration
.
.
.
commit
|
commitdiff
|
tree
2010-04-07
Henri Verbe
e
t
wined3d: Pass the correct window to Present(
)
i
n IWineGDISur
.
.
.
commit
|
commitdiff
|
tree
2010-04-07
Henr
i
Verb
e
et
w
ined3d:
Pass t
h
e cor
r
ect
window t
o
Present() in IW
i
n
e
D
3DSur
.
.
.
commit
|
commitdiff
|
tree
2010-04-07
Henri Verbeet
wined3d:
P
ass the co
r
r
e
ct window
to Present()
i
n IW
i
n
e
D3DSur
.
.
.
commit
|
commitdiff
|
tree
2010-04-07
Henri
Ver
b
eet
quart
z
: D
o
n't return a pointer t
o
a st
a
ck variable
.
.
.
commit
|
commitdiff
|
tree
2010-04-06
H
enr
i
Ve
r
b
e
et
ddraw: Fix and clarify
t
e
xture filter st
a
t
e
m
appings
.
commit
|
commitdiff
|
tree
2010-04-06
Hen
r
i Verbeet
wine
d
3
d: Capture the correct
scissor rectangl
e
.
commit
|
commitdiff
|
tree
2010-04-06
Henri Verbeet
win
e
d3
d
: Don't u
s
e GLSL if t
h
e su
p
porte
d
version isn
.
.
.
commit
|
commitdiff
|
tree
2010-04-06
Henri Verb
e
et
d
3d8/tests
:
C
l
ear with colors that are more obviou
s
ly
.
.
.
commit
|
commitdiff
|
tree
2010-04-06
Henr
i
Verbeet
d3
d
8/te
s
ts: U
s
e color_match
(
)
in test_rcp_rsq()
.
commit
|
commitdiff
|
tree
2010-04-05
Henri Verbeet
wined3d: Rename some GL vendors
.
commit
|
commitdiff
|
tree
2010-04-05
Henri
V
erbeet
wined3d: Rename HW_VE
N
DOR_WINE to HW_VEND
O
R_SOF
T
WARE
.
commit
|
commitdiff
|
tree
2010-04-05
Henri V
e
rbeet
wined3d
:
M
a
ke some functions s
t
a
ti
c
.
commit
|
commitdiff
|
tree
2010-04-05
Henri Verbe
e
t
win
e
d3
d
: Si
m
ply i
n
line dumpResourc
e
s()
.
commit
|
commitdiff
|
tree
2010-04-05
Hen
r
i Verbeet
wined3d: Add a sepa
r
a
te f
u
nction f
o
r wined3d object
.
.
.
commit
|
commitdiff
|
tree
2010-04-02
H
e
n
ri
Verbeet
w
i
ned
3
d: Verify al
l
render sta
t
es ha
v
e
a
h
a
ndler
.
commit
|
commitdiff
|
tree
2010-04-02
H
e
nri Ver
b
eet
w
ined3d
:
Move ha
n
d
ling of t
h
e un
i
mplemen
t
ed WINED
3
DRS_STIPPL
.
.
.
commit
|
commitdiff
|
tree
2010-04-02
Henri Verbeet
w
i
n
e
d3d:
M
o
v
e hand
l
ing of
the unimple
m
ented
W
INED3DRS_BO
R
DER
.
.
.
commit
|
commitdiff
|
tree
2010-04-02
Henri
Verbeet
win
e
d3d: Remove
s
ome un
u
sed render states
.
commit
|
commitdiff
|
tree
2010-04-02
Henri Verbeet
wined3d: Add a state handl
e
r for
WINED3DRS_Z
V
ISIBLE
.
commit
|
commitdiff
|
tree
2010-04-02
Hen
r
i Verbeet
w
i
ne
d
3d: Verify state representatives represen
t
themse
l
ve
s
.
commit
|
commitdiff
|
tree
2010-04-01
H
e
nri Verbeet
w
ined3d: R
e
move some superfluous white space and braces
.
.
.
commit
|
commitdiff
|
tree
2010-04-01
Henri Verbeet
wined3d: Add a st
a
te table entry for WINE
D
3DR
S
_INDEXEDV
E
RTEX
.
.
.
commit
|
commitdiff
|
tree
2010-04-01
Henr
i
Ver
b
e
e
t
wined3d
:
Verify each state table entry
has either a
.
.
.
commit
|
commitdiff
|
tree
2010-04-01
He
n
ri Verbeet
w
i
ned3d
:
Explicit
l
y set the
s
t
a
te han
d
ler
t
o NUL
L
for
.
.
.
commit
|
commitdiff
|
tree
2010-04-01
Henri Verbeet
wined3d: Use the r
e
p
i
nstead
of the apply
f
unction
.
.
.
commit
|
commitdiff
|
tree
2010-04-01
H
e
n
ri Verbeet
wined3d: Don't call directly int
o
the
s
tate ta
b
le
.
commit
|
commitdiff
|
tree
2010-03-31
Henri Ver
b
ee
t
wined3d: Add a state table entry fo
r
WINED3
D
R
S
_TWE
E
NF
A
CTOR
.
commit
|
commitdiff
|
tree
2010-03-31
Henri Verbeet
wine
d
3d: Print a FIXM
E
/WA
R
N fo
r
all unsuppor
t
ed vert
e
x
.
.
.
commit
|
commitdiff
|
tree
2010-03-31
Henri
V
e
rbeet
wined3d: Remove some unuse
d
/
duplicate r
e
nder states
.
commit
|
commitdiff
|
tree
2010-03-31
H
e
nri
V
e
rbeet
wined3d: Re
m
ove a
r
edundant initialization in IWineD3DDevi
c
e
.
.
.
commit
|
commitdiff
|
tree
2010-03-31
Henri Ve
r
beet
wined3d: Get
rid
of some mostly useless
l
ocal va
r
iabl
e
s
.
.
.
commit
|
commitdiff
|
tree
2010-03-31
Henr
i
Verbeet
wi
n
ed3d
:
C
leanup variable naming in IWineD3DDevice
I
mpl_Up
d
at
.
.
.
commit
|
commitdiff
|
tree
2010-03-30
Henri Verbeet
w
i
ne
d
3d: G
e
t r
i
d
of destForm
a
t
and sr
c
Forma
t
in
IWineD3DD
e
vi
.
.
.
commit
|
commitdiff
|
tree
2010-03-30
Henri Verbee
t
wined
3
d:
C
a
l
c
ulate
"of
f
set
"
in the a
p
propriate path
.
.
.
commit
|
commitdiff
|
tree
2010-03-30
Hen
r
i Verbeet
wined3d: Add
mo
r
e general support for partial upda
t
es
.
.
.
commit
|
commitdiff
|
tree
2010-03-30
H
e
n
ri Verbeet
wined3d:
Sour
c
e
a
nd destinati
o
n
formats
s
hould match
.
.
.
commit
|
commitdiff
|
tree
2010-03-30
H
e
n
r
i Verbeet
wined3d:
Use GL_UNPACK
_
ROW_LENGTH for partial u
p
d
a
t
e
s
.
.
.
commit
|
commitdiff
|
tree
2010-03-30
H
e
n
ri Ve
r
b
e
et
wined3
d
: Initialization funct
i
ons
don't allocat
e
.
commit
|
commitdiff
|
tree
2010-03-29
Henri Verbeet
wined3d:
G
L
e
rrors aren
'
t
F
IX
M
Es
.
commit
|
commitdiff
|
tree
2010-03-29
Henri Ver
b
eet
ddrawex/tests:
Add
s
ome tests for GetSurfaceF
r
omDC()
.
commit
|
commitdiff
|
tree
2010-03-29
Henri Ver
b
eet
ddrawex: C
o
rrectly retr
i
ev
e
the
"
out
e
r" surfa
c
e
i
n
.
.
.
commit
|
commitdiff
|
tree
2010-03-29
Henri Ve
r
beet
ddrawex: Direct
l
y r
e
turn the ddraw surface i
n
IDi
r
ectDr
a
w4Im
.
.
.
commit
|
commitdiff
|
tree
2010-03-29
Henri Verbeet
ntdll:
Ret
u
rn a
mor
e
reas
o
nable val
u
e for "Reserved3"
.
commit
|
commitdiff
|
tree
2010-03-29
Henri Ve
r
beet
i
n
clude: Specif
y
some fields of
t
h
e SYSTEM_P
E
R
FORMAN
C
E
_
INFOR
.
.
.
commit
|
commitdiff
|
tree
2010-03-26
Henri Verbeet
wined
3
d: Add sup
p
ort fo
r
parti
a
l
u
pda
t
es o
f
com
p
re
s
sed
.
.
.
commit
|
commitdiff
|
tree
2010-03-26
H
e
n
ri V
e
rbeet
wined3d: Don't warn about independent color
w
rite masks
.
.
.
commit
|
commitdiff
|
tree
2010-03-26
Henri V
e
rbeet
wi
n
ed3
d
: Implement in
d
ependent
c
ol
o
r write ma
s
ks
.
commit
|
commitdiff
|
tree
2010-03-26
H
enri Ve
r
beet
win
e
d3d: Add supp
o
rt for EXT_draw_buffer
s
2
.
commit
|
commitdiff
|
tree
2010-03-26
Henri
Ver
b
eet
wined3d:
g
lColorMask() changes the write mask for all
.
.
.
commit
|
commitdiff
|
tree
2010-03-26
H
e
nri Verbeet
w
i
n
e
d3d: Add GL
l
ocking
t
o
m
a
tc
h
_fbo
_
te
x
_update(
)
.
commit
|
commitdiff
|
tree
2010-03-25
H
e
nri Verb
e
et
d
3d8/tests: Add s
o
me message p
r
oce
s
sing to test_wndproc()
.
commit
|
commitdiff
|
tree
2010-03-25
H
enri Verbeet
d3d9/test
s
: Add some me
s
sage processing
t
o test_wndp
r
oc()
.
commit
|
commitdiff
|
tree
2010-03-25
Henr
i
Verbeet
wined3d: Just mark t
h
e color wr
i
t
e mas
k
dirty in IWineD3
D
Dev
.
.
.
commit
|
commitdiff
|
tree
2010-03-25
Henri
Verbeet
w
i
ned3d:
U
se the
same o
r
de
r
of operations for depth
.
.
.
commit
|
commitdiff
|
tree
2010-03-25
Henri Verb
e
et
wined
3
d: Just mark the
s
tencil wr
i
te
m
ask dirty in
.
.
.
commit
|
commitdiff
|
tree
2010-03-25
He
n
ri Verbeet
wined
3
d
:
D
isable two-sided stencil when doin
g
stencil
.
.
.
commit
|
commitdiff
|
tree
2010-03-19
H
e
nri V
e
rbeet
w
ined3d:
Ad
d
C
O
MPLEX
_
FIXUP_N
O
N
E
as value 0 to
the co
m
plex
_
fi
.
.
.
commit
|
commitdiff
|
tree
2010-03-19
He
n
ri Ve
r
beet
wined3d
:
Unify
"
gl_
f
ormat
s
_tem
p
late
"
nam
i
ng wi
t
h the
.
.
.
commit
|
commitdiff
|
tree
2010-03-19
Henri
V
erbeet
w
i
ned3
d
: Rename GlP
i
x
elFormatDesc to wine
d
3d_format
_
desc
.
commit
|
commitdiff
|
tree
2010-03-19
Henri V
e
r
beet
wined3d: Simpl
i
fy the generat
e
d
G
LSL for NRM
.
commit
|
commitdiff
|
tree
2010-03-18
H
e
n
r
i
Ver
b
ee
t
wi
n
ed3d: Avoid so
m
e common inva
l
id cont
e
xt accesses
.
commit
|
commitdiff
|
tree
2010-03-18
He
n
r
i
Verbeet
w
ined3d: Kill VTRACE
.
commit
|
commitdiff
|
tree
2010-03-18
H
enri Verbeet
wined3d
:
Replace some VTRACE
s
with pro
p
er TRACEs
.
commit
|
commitdiff
|
tree
2010-03-18
Henri Verbeet
wi
n
ed
3
d: Add a qu
i
r
k to rebind FBOs when
one of their
.
.
.
commit
|
commitdiff
|
tree
2010-03-18
H
enri Verbeet
wi
n
ed3d: Unify GLIN
F
O_LOCATION
i
n surface
.
c
.
commit
|
commitdiff
|
tree
2010-03-18
Henri V
e
rbeet
d
draw: Acquire/
r
elease the focus w
i
nd
o
w from
the
c
orrect
.
.
.
commit
|
commitdiff
|
tree
2010-03-18
Hen
r
i
V
erbeet
wi
n
ed3d:
Make
the
f
o
cus w
i
ndow also th
e
f
ore
g
round
.
.
.
commit
|
commitdiff
|
tree
2010-03-18
Henri Verbeet
d3d9/tests:
E
xtend the wi
n
dow proc /
f
o
cus window tests
.
commit
|
commitdiff
|
tree
2010-03-18
Hen
r
i Verbe
e
t
d3d8/tests:
Extend the wind
o
w proc /
focus window test
s
.
commit
|
commitdiff
|
tree
2010-03-18
H
enri Verbe
e
t
user32/t
e
sts: Add a test fo
r
foreground windows on
.
.
.
commit
|
commitdiff
|
tree
2010-03-17
He
n
ri Verbeet
ddraw: Fix
I
Dire
c
tDraw4Impl
_
GetSurfaceFromDC
(
)
.
commit
|
commitdiff
|
tree
2010-03-17
Henri Verbe
e
t
ddraw:
I
m
p
leme
n
t
I
Direc
t
Dra
w
Im
p
l_
G
etSur
f
aceFrom
D
C()
.
commit
|
commitdiff
|
tree
2010-03-17
Henri Ve
r
beet
wined3d: Clean
u
p
I
WineD3DDev
i
c
eI
m
pl_SetF
r
o
nt
B
ack
B
uff
e
r
s()
.
commit
|
commitdiff
|
tree
2010-03-17
H
e
nri
Verbeet
wined3d
:
D
o
n't
c
hange t
h
e
draw buffe
r
in IWi
n
eD3DDe
v
iceImpl_
.
.
.
commit
|
commitdiff
|
tree
2010-03-17
Henri Verbeet
wi
n
ed3d: Simpl
i
fy the IWineD3DDeviceIm
p
l
_Cl
e
arSurface
.
.
.
commit
|
commitdiff
|
tree
2010-03-17
Henri
Ver
b
eet
wine
d
3
d: Si
m
plify
context_apply_att
a
chmen
t
_filter_states
.
.
.
commit
|
commitdiff
|
tree
2010-03-17
Henri Verbeet
wined3d: Add missing check
G
Lcall'
s
to bu
f
fer
_
Ma
p
()
.
commit
|
commitdiff
|
tree
2010-03-17
Henri Verbeet
win
e
d
3d: Do
n
't use framebuff
e
r blit for b
a
ck
b
uff
e
r
.
.
.
commit
|
commitdiff
|
tree
2010-03-17
Henri Verb
e
e
t
w
i
ned3d: Do
n
't use filtering on textures that n
e
e
d
.
.
.
commit
|
commitdiff
|
tree
2010-03-17
Henri Verbeet
win
e
d3d
:
Use "gl_filter
"
in the
non-FBO pa
t
h of
s
wapch
a
in_bl
.
.
.
commit
|
commitdiff
|
tree
2010-03-16
Henri
Verbeet
wi
n
ed3d: Im
p
lement
S
e
tDestWindowOverride() by simply
.
.
.
commit
|
commitdiff
|
tree
2010-03-16
Henri Verbeet
win
e
d3d:
S
tore the devic
e
window
in
the swapcha
i
n
.
commit
|
commitdiff
|
tree
2010-03-16
Henri
V
erbeet
wined3d: Simplif
y
a comparison in I
W
ineD3DD
e
viceImpl_Reset(
)
.
commit
|
commitdiff
|
tree
2010-03-16
Henri
V
e
rbeet
win
e
d3d: The swapchai
n
s
hould alway
s
have a windo
w
.
.
.
commit
|
commitdiff
|
tree
2010-03-16
Henri V
e
rbeet
wined3d: Use the cont
e
xt's window handle in IWine
D
3
D
SurfaceI
.
.
.
commit
|
commitdiff
|
tree
2010-03-16
H
enr
i
Verbeet
wined3d: Use the c
o
nte
x
t's
w
indow ha
n
dle in stretch_rect_fbo()
.
commit
|
commitdiff
|
tree
next